Sailaab ( The flood )



'Sailaab' was one of the 'extramarital affairs serials' popular at that time ( 90s ) on Zee TV , the other being 'Hasratein' ( desires ).

The serial shows two young lovers in love with one another in Mumbai/Bombay---Sachin Khedekar and Renuka Shahane . Sachin is struggling in the ad industry , and has come from another town . He is a hard worker , but does not have much money . But big city girl Renuka Shahane is bowled over by his honesty and simplicity and soon they are in love . They meet secretly and later openly and seem perfect for each other .

But Renuka's big brother Raju Kher is not impressed . He is okay as far as Sachin is coming to his house as Renuka's friend , but is dead against the marriage . Reason---Sachin is not equal to his family financially . Of course , he feels Sachin is a good boy and has nothing against him . But does not want him to marry his sister . Raju has big dreams of marrying his beloved sister to a rich man , and asks her to cut off the relationship .

But Renuka decides to elope with Sachin . When Raju hears of this he pours petrol on himself and threatens to kill himself by burning himself to death if Renuka elopes . Under severe pressure Renuka crumbles and agrees to end the relationship . When Sachin hears of this he is devastated . At the same time he hears of his father's death and the world collapses around him .

Renuka is married off to another person , a rich doctor played first by Ajinkya Dev and later by Mahesh Thakur---the change in actors being a phenomena of long TV serials . And Sachin---he rises like a phoenix from the ashes to work hard and carve a name for himself . Yes , he becomes a successful man . Prajakti Deshmukh , who is Renuka's friend marries him . She has known of his former love and is warned by her parents that Sachin has not got over his love for Renuka , but she disregards this advice and marries Sachin . Her parents are opposed to the marriage and do not attend the marriage .

Years later Sachin's and Renuka's paths cross again , and old sparks fly again . They discover that they never stopped loving each other . And they want to meet---again and again . Clandestine meetings are sought and they begin to date again on the sly . Soon they realise that if they cannot meet even for a single day then they feel an emptiness....On the surface they pretend to be happy in the respective marriages but reality is different .

So what will happen when their respective partners ( Prajakti Deshmukh and Mahesh Thakur ) discover what is happening ? Will it lead to Sailaab---the flood....

On seeing a few episodes of the serial on youtube recently , I was struck by how old the serial looks . No HD format , no wide screen format---for it was made 20 years ago when TV had not switched to this technology . The world was of the early nineties---so no mobile phones . The era was old too---women did not smoke or drink even when the people shown were sophisticated city people because westernization had not seeped in at that time. Above all , even when the lovers meet in restaurants there is not sex or even kissing---the relationship between Sachin and Shivani remains physically chaste all the time because the Indian middle class audience which watched the serial at that time ( 90s ) was not prepared for that .

This being a TV serial , everything happens in slow motion---for the whole story is to be dragged over 90+ episodes of 23 minutes each . But the serial is embellished with superb songs by Talat Aziz and the late Jagjit Singh , and these heighten the emotion and sensitivity of the scenes . Indeed music is the high point of the serial , and it has many emotional scenes acted very well .

The serial went on to become a success , and was ZEE TV's number one serial at that time . Ravi Rai who directed it became a much sought after director , directing other TV serials like 'Teacher' . Years later watching the serial on youtube today , I found myself again interested....

Tula pahatey rey ( Dear I am watching you )



I am currently watching this TV serial because my parents watch it every night ; yeah I live with my parents .
It involves actor Subodh Bhave playing Vikram Saranjame , who is a self made man . He is a person who has grown up from the slums to raising a successful business through sheer hard work . All along he has been helped by his friend who stood behind him like a rock .

Vikram's immediate family has reaped the benefits of his success and lead comfortable lives . His younger brother has got married and his wife leads a luxurious existence on her brother in law's money . She is lazy and neither she nor her husband work hard . But neither do they have any gratitude for the money that Vikram has showered on them . Vikram is rather alone at the top....

Vikram is now in his mid forties and past the age when indian men get married . Half his life has gone in his struggle to reach the top . Of course , some selfish women are ready to marry him for his money . But what he really needs is a life partner , not a gold digger .

At this stage in his life into his office comes a simple girl named Isha ( Gayatri Datar ) who is not a beauty but has a heart . She too has grown in a slum and lives there still . Her father has to face humiliations due to his poor financial status .

Maybe because they both grew up in a slum or maybe because they are both nice people , Isha and Vikrant begin to unknowingly care for each other as they are thrown together in many situations in the office . And it is Isha who first falls in love . But how can she express her love for Vikrant ? She of financially unequal status.....

The bigger impediment is the considerable age difference between them . Isha is barely in her mid twenties and is twenty years younger then Vikrant . Her parents would be shocked if they came to know of her feelings . They try to fix her marriage to someone else but it fizzles out .

And what about Vikrant's feelings ? Yes he is slowly falling in love with Isha , but is reluctant to admit it to himself . Instead he tries to help in getting Isha married but finds out negative things about the boy and his family and plays a role in getting the engagement cancelled . Exactly what Isha wanted.....

But she is no gold digger , and is willing to follow Vikrant even if his financial condition suffered and fell . In fact it is his higher status that is upto now preventing Isha from coming out openly with her feelings . But the cup of waiting brimmeth over.....her friends are already putting pressure on her to propose to Vikrant Sir , as she calls him .

A soothsayer has already told her parents that Isha will get married in a month . But will his family accept a daughter in law from the slums ? What lies ahead even if the marriage occurs ?
